Transaction 661b55d89cc21f9bf3b1f203e65a28af4f0fba1ca3371f22be4db6dd662cd2aa
1 Input
1 Output
-
661b55d89cc21f9bf3b1f203e65a28af4f0fba1ca3371f22be4db6dd662cd2aa:0
- value
- 37680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ea88621c7869dd8ea4fe305814a8d8eb93e37b35 OP_EQUAL
- address
- 3P57RWK6NVMq584A6kT8FKi3d4B51YMn6W